开源项目:TimelineExtension 使用与安装指南

开源项目:TimelineExtension 使用与安装指南

TimelineExtension Windows Timeline & Project Rome Web Extension TimelineExtension 项目地址: https://gitcode.com/gh_mirrors/ti/TimelineExtension

一、项目目录结构及介绍

DominicMaas/TimelineExtension 是一个旨在将Windows Timeline支持集成到流行浏览器中的开源扩展。以下是其主要目录结构概览:

  • src
    • 存放源代码文件,包括核心逻辑和前端界面。
      • scripts: 包含JavaScript脚本,用于扩展的功能实现。
      • vscode: 可能是开发过程中使用的Visual Studio Code配置相关文件。
  • webpack: 现代Web应用常用的构建工具配置目录,用于打包和优化项目资源。
  • gitignore: 指定Git应忽略哪些文件或目录的文件。
  • FAQ.md: 常见问题解答文档,帮助解决用户在使用过程中可能遇到的问题。
  • LICENSE: 许可证文件,声明了项目遵循MIT许可协议。
  • README.md: 项目简介,快速入门指导。
  • package-lock.json, package.json: NPM依赖管理文件,记录项目所需的具体依赖版本。
  • tsconfig.json, tslint.json: TypeScript编译配置和代码规范配置文件。

二、项目的启动文件介绍

此项目依赖于Node.js环境进行构建与调试。虽然没有明确指出“启动文件”,但基于常规的Node.js和Webpack项目结构,关键的“启动”操作通常涉及脚本命令。npm scripts是执行任务的主要方式,其中:

  • npm install: 安装所有项目所需的依赖包。
  • npm run build: 编译项目,生成可以在浏览器中运行的生产就绪代码。
  • npm run watch: 在开发模式下运行,自动编译并监听文件变化以即时更新。

因此,并非传统意义上的单一“启动文件”,而是通过上述npm命令来启动编译或开发服务器。

三、项目的配置文件介绍

  1. package.json: 这个文件是项目的心脏,包含了项目的元数据、依赖项、以及定义好的npm脚本(如前所述的install, build, watch命令)。

  2. tsconfig.json: TypeScript配置文件,指示TypeScript编译器如何处理项目中的TypeScript代码,包括编译目标、源码路径等。

  3. webpack.config.js: 虽然直接的配置文件路径未给出,但基于上下文,Webpack的配置文件控制着资源的打包流程,决定怎样从源代码生成最终的浏览器可用文件。

  4. .gitignore: 版控忽略文件,指定不希望被Git跟踪的文件类型或具体文件,比如node_modules目录,编译后的文件等。

综上所述,通过理解这些核心文件及其作用,开发者可以顺利地搭建项目环境,编译源码,并对TimelineExtension进行定制或调试。

TimelineExtension Windows Timeline & Project Rome Web Extension TimelineExtension 项目地址: https://gitcode.com/gh_mirrors/ti/TimelineExtension

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

平钰垚Zebediah

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值